My Top five Growth Languages for Making an E-Commerce Web-site - Gustavo Woltmann Picks



From the rapidly evolving digital landscape, e-commerce Sites are very important for companies trying to get to expand their achieve and offer you goods or companies on the net. Deciding on the right improvement language is vital for developing a strong, scalable, and person-welcoming e-commerce System. The language you choose will impact the web site's functionality, protection, overall flexibility, and Over-all person working experience. In this article’s a think about the leading five improvement languages for making an e-commerce Internet site, determined by my, Gustavo Woltmann's personalized Choices, Each individual featuring one of a kind pros.

 

 

JavaScript



JavaScript happens to be a cornerstone during the realm of World-wide-web progress, particularly for building dynamic, interactive e-commerce Web-sites. Its flexibility and talent to run seamlessly across all important Internet browsers make it a most popular option for developers looking to build responsive and interesting person interfaces.

One of several crucial advantages of JavaScript is its capacity to build hugely interactive Internet sites. Inside the competitive environment of e-commerce, consumer encounter is paramount, and JavaScript excels at offering characteristics that improve this encounter. Whether it’s authentic-time updates, interactive product or service displays, or responsive structure aspects, JavaScript offers the resources desired to make a Web-site that not merely appears captivating but additionally engages customers correctly.

In addition, JavaScript boasts an in depth ecosystem of libraries and frameworks that simplify the event method. Preferred frameworks like Respond, Angular, and Vue.js permit builders to build sophisticated entrance-finish interfaces promptly and efficiently. These frameworks give pre-developed factors and templates, lowering the effort and time needed to build strong e-commerce platforms. Additionally, JavaScript’s compatibility with different again-end technologies makes certain a sleek integration in between the front-stop and server-aspect operations, contributing to some seamless searching working experience for customers.

JavaScript’s cross-browser compatibility is an additional substantial benefit. E-commerce Internet websites must perform flawlessly across unique equipment and browsers to reach the widest attainable viewers. JavaScript ensures that interactive attributes and responsive types get the job done continuously, regardless of the consumer’s browser or product, thus maximizing the accessibility and usefulness of the web site.

Furthermore, JavaScript’s genuine-time abilities are specially valuable for e-commerce websites. Attributes including Dwell chat, dynamic articles updates, and true-time inventory administration is usually executed effectively using JavaScript, enabling businesses to provide a far more personalized and effective purchasing expertise.

 

 

PHP



PHP has extended been a staple in Net advancement, especially for developing dynamic and feature-wealthy e-commerce Web sites. As a server-facet scripting language, PHP is noted for its overall flexibility, ease of use, and robust integration with databases, making it an ideal option for acquiring the back again-stop of e-commerce platforms.

Certainly one of the primary strengths of PHP lies in its robust server-facet abilities. E-commerce Internet sites require a robust back again-finish to take care of processes for instance consumer authentication, payment processing, and inventory administration. PHP excels in these regions, supplying a reliable framework for running complex server-aspect operations. Its power to proficiently interact with databases, for instance MySQL, makes sure that data can be saved, retrieved, and manipulated seamlessly, which can be important for keeping accurate product or service listings, processing orders, and controlling customer information and facts.

PHP’s extensive ecosystem is another important advantage for e-commerce progress. You'll find various open-resource platforms and frameworks created with PHP, such as Magento, WooCommerce, and OpenCart. These platforms deliver pre-developed methods for producing e-commerce Web-sites, total with capabilities like searching carts, product catalogs, and checkout programs. Builders can leverage these platforms to rapidly build and customise a web-based retail store, minimizing improvement time and charges. Additionally, PHP frameworks like Laravel and Symfony supply State-of-the-art features and resources that simplify the event of tailor made e-commerce remedies, furnishing scalability and flexibility because the small business grows.

The open up-resource nature of PHP contributes to its Expense-success, which is particularly helpful for smaller to medium-sized enterprises seeking to build an e-commerce Internet site devoid of significant upfront expenditure. Due to the fact PHP is no cost to use, companies can allocate their price range in direction of other essential areas of their e-commerce strategy, including advertising and marketing or buyer acquisition.

A different noteworthy facet of PHP is its prevalent internet hosting help. Most Webhosting vendors present great compatibility with PHP, guaranteeing that e-commerce Sites created with PHP might be very easily deployed and taken care of. This common assist signifies that businesses have a wide range of web hosting solutions to pick from, making it possible for them to pick the top provider primarily based on their precise demands and price range.

In conclusion, PHP continues to be a prime option for e-commerce growth as a result of its strong server-facet capabilities, in depth ecosystem, Price tag-performance, and prevalent hosting aid. No matter if utilizing a pre-built System or building a custom Resolution, PHP offers the resources and adaptability necessary to create An effective and scalable e-commerce Web site.

 

 

Python



Python has attained considerable popularity in World wide web improvement, especially for making scalable and secure e-commerce Internet websites. Known for its simplicity, readability, and highly effective frameworks, Python gives a sturdy foundation for establishing intricate e-commerce platforms that may take care of high targeted traffic and advanced functionalities.

One among Python's most noteworthy strengths is its ease of use. Python's easy syntax can make it available to both of those beginner and expert builders, enabling them to center on solving difficulties in lieu of receiving slowed down by complex code structures. This simplicity accelerates the development course of action, making it easier to Construct and retain large-scale e-commerce Sites. For enterprises, this translates into quicker time-to-market place and minimized development expenses, that happen to be important in the aggressive e-commerce landscape.

Python is likewise really regarded for its scalability, a critical aspect for e-commerce platforms that require to deal with developing consumer bases and enhanced transaction volumes. Python's scalability is supported by its capacity to integrate with various databases, cloud solutions, and third-celebration APIs, making certain that the e-commerce platform can expand and adapt to altering enterprise desires. Frameworks like Django, which happens to be crafted on Python, further more greatly enhance scalability by furnishing an extensive set of tools for setting up strong World-wide-web purposes. Django's “batteries-bundled” solution signifies that a lot of crucial functions, like user authentication, content administration, and databases conversation, are created in to the framework, permitting builders to center on customizing the System to meet specific small business requirements.

Stability is an additional location where Python excels, rendering it a chosen choice for e-commerce enhancement. The safety of an e-commerce Web-site is paramount, as it promotions with sensitive consumer details, like payment info. Python frameworks like Django give created-in security features, for instance safety towards SQL injection, cross-web page scripting (XSS), and cross-internet site request forgery (CSRF), which support safeguard the platform from widespread Internet vulnerabilities. These capabilities, combined with Python's power to simply put into action encryption and protected info managing methods, make sure the e-commerce platform is very well-protected from potential protection threats.

In addition, Python's flexibility extends to its ability to help Highly developed functionalities including synthetic intelligence (AI) and machine Finding out (ML). These systems could be leveraged to improve the e-commerce knowledge through customized tips, predictive analytics, and chatbots, all of which add to larger purchaser satisfaction and improved profits. Python’s rich ecosystem of libraries, including TensorFlow and scikit-study, makes it simpler to combine AI and ML abilities into an e-commerce System, supplying firms that has a aggressive edge.

 

 

Ruby on Rails



Ruby on Rails, frequently often called Rails or RoR, is a robust Net software framework that has grown to be a favorite option for building e-commerce Internet sites. Recognized for its emphasis on convention in excess of configuration, Rails allows builders to build robust, scalable, and feature-rich e-commerce platforms rapidly and effectively.

One of several standout characteristics of Ruby on Rails is its capacity to speed up the event course of action. Rails is meant to streamline Website advancement by offering a structured surroundings in which developers can stick to predefined conventions. This “convention more than configuration” philosophy minimizes the need for tedious set up and configuration jobs, allowing builders to center on making the Main functions in the e-commerce platform. As a result, enterprises can bring their e-commerce Web-sites to current market faster, attaining a aggressive benefit in the fast evolving on the net retail Room.

Yet another substantial benefit of Ruby on Rails is its sturdy Neighborhood support and in depth library of reusable factors, often known as gems. These gems protect a wide range of functionalities, from payment gateways and stock management to Search engine optimization optimization and customer opinions. By leveraging these pre-created modules, developers can noticeably decrease the time and effort needed to put into action complex capabilities within an e-commerce platform. This modular approach also makes sure that the System might be effortlessly tailored and extended as the small business grows or as new specifications arise.

Scalability is another critical strength of Ruby on Rails, which makes it an acceptable choice for e-commerce businesses of all measurements. Rails is crafted with scalability in mind, permitting the System to take care of escalating targeted visitors and transaction volumes without having compromising general performance. Because the business enterprise grows, the Rails framework can accommodate extra servers, databases, and expert services, ensuring that the e-commerce System continues to be responsive and reputable. This scalability is very important for e-commerce Web sites that assume to experience considerable expansion in person numbers and income after some time.

Ruby on Rails also emphasizes security, that is essential for any e-commerce System handling sensitive client facts and economical transactions. Rails comes with constructed-in safety features that defend versus common vulnerabilities like SQL injection, cross-web site scripting (XSS), and cross-internet site ask for forgery (CSRF). Additionally, the Rails community actively maintains and updates the framework to address emerging safety threats, making certain that e-commerce platforms developed with Rails continue to be safe and compliant with marketplace benchmarks.

Furthermore, Ruby on Rails supports agile development practices, making it an excellent choice for organizations that prioritize constant enhancement and adaptability. The Rails framework encourages check-driven improvement (TDD) and supports automated testing, allowing builders to immediately identify and fix issues just before they influence the Reside platform. This agile solution makes certain that the e-commerce Web page can evolve in reaction to purchaser responses, market place developments, and technological breakthroughs, maintaining the company aggressive inside a dynamic atmosphere.

 

 

Java



Java is a lengthy-standing and really trusted programming language that's been widely Employed in company-degree applications, together with e-commerce platforms. Recognized for its robustness, scalability, and safety, Java is a wonderful option for producing intricate, large-efficiency e-commerce Web sites that need to manage big volumes of transactions and users.

Considered one of Java's most important advantages is its platform independence. Java’s "write the moment, run any place" philosophy makes certain that programs crafted with Java can run on any machine or working system that supports the Java Virtual Equipment (JVM). This cross-platform capacity is particularly effective for e-commerce organizations that want to succeed in a broad viewers, because it makes sure steady general performance across many gadgets, from desktops to cellular devices. This universality would make Java an attractive choice for setting up e-commerce platforms that have to be available and reliable across unique environments.

Scalability is an additional significant strength of Java, which makes it perfect for e-commerce platforms envisioned to develop after some time. Java’s architecture is designed to manage substantial-scale applications effectively, making it possible for enterprises to scale their e-commerce Web sites as targeted traffic and transaction volumes maximize. Java supports multithreading, which allows the platform to course of action various transactions simultaneously, making certain a easy and responsive consumer expertise even through peak shopping periods. In addition, Java’s substantial ecosystem of instruments and libraries, for instance Spring and Hibernate, presents builders Using the methods required to Make and manage scalable e-commerce platforms that can grow Using the company.

Java is here additionally renowned for its safety features, that happen to be critical for e-commerce apps that take care of sensitive client details, including payment specifics and personal info. Java gives robust security mechanisms, including encryption, authentication, and obtain Command, to shield versus prevalent protection threats like SQL injection, cross-web site scripting (XSS), and info breaches. The language's powerful security product, coupled with typical updates along with a vigilant community, ensures that e-commerce platforms crafted with Java continue being safe and compliant with business standards, which include PCI-DSS for payment processing.

A different essential advantage of Java in e-commerce enhancement is its capacity to integrate with many databases, APIs, and 3rd-celebration services. E-commerce platforms generally count on complicated again-conclusion techniques to manage stock, procedure payments, and produce customized user activities. Java’s in depth aid for database connectivity, through systems like JDBC (Java Databases Connectivity), assures seamless conversation amongst the e-commerce System and its underlying details sources. Furthermore, Java’s compatibility with various APIs and its capability to combine with enterprise devices like ERP (Enterprise Source Planning) and CRM (Buyer Relationship Management) methods allow it to be a flexible choice for creating in depth e-commerce ecosystems.

In addition, Java's significant and active Neighborhood contributes to its ongoing relevance and innovation. The Group continually develops and maintains a variety of open-supply libraries, frameworks, and instruments that simplify the event procedure and prolong Java’s functionality. This collaborative surroundings makes sure that Java continues to be a cutting-edge technological innovation, effective at Conference the evolving demands of contemporary e-commerce.

 

 

Closing Criteria



Choosing the proper progress language for an e-commerce Web-site is a choice which will noticeably impact the platform's accomplishment. JavaScript, PHP, Python, Ruby on Rails, and Java Just about every give unique strengths, catering to various facets of e-commerce growth—from interactive consumer interfaces to protected again-conclusion processing. The selection finally depends on the specific requirements from the enterprise, the complexity of the website, and the desired consumer practical experience. By picking out the right language, enterprises can Establish a robust e-commerce System that don't just satisfies latest calls for but is likewise scalable for long run expansion.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“My Top five Growth Languages for Making an E-Commerce Web-site - Gustavo Woltmann Picks”

Leave a Reply

Gravatar